OBJECTIVE: To compare the recovery rates of Campylobacter fetus subsp venerealis (Cfv) from preputial scrapings of infected bulls with passive filtration on selective medium versus nonselective medium, with and without transport medium. SAMPLES: 217 preputial scrapings from 12 bulls (4 naturally and 8 artificially infected with Cfv). PROCEDURES: Preputial scrapings were collected in 2 mL of PBS solution and bacteriologically cultured directly on Skirrow medium or passively filtered through 0.65-μm filters onto blood agar, with or without 24 hour preincubation in modified Weybridge transport enrichment medium (TEM). After 72 hours, plates were examined for Cfv and bacterial and fungal contamination or overgrowth. RESULTS: Passive filtration of fresh preputial scrapings onto blood agar yielded significantly higher recovery rates of Cfv (86%) than direct plating on Skirrow medium (32%), whereas recovery from TEM was poor for both media (35% and 40%, respectively). Skirrow cultures without TEM were significantly more likely to have fungal contamination than were cultures performed with any other technique, and fungal contamination was virtually eliminated by passive filtration onto blood agar. Bacterial contamination by Pseudomonas spp was significantly more common with Skirrow medium versus passive filtration on blood agar, regardless of TEM use. CONCLUSIONS AND CLINICAL RELEVANCE: The use of transport medium and the choice of culture medium had significant effects on Cfv recovery and culture contamination rates from clinical samples. Both factors should be considered when animals are tested for this pathogen.
